I really enjoy the shows we attend.I find lights are very important.I have a few spotlights from Ikea at £10 a go and they look good and highlight special pieces.Also lots of cards/postcards(good old Vistaprint).I spend a lot of time talking to people and it sometimes feels like a waste of time but business info is taken and orders sometimes come in straight after the show or months afterwards.I feel by going to the shows people can see your work as photo's never seem to do it full justice.Also I think customers seem to want different and more individual work now and your work is so good I'm sure if will fly off the table.Very best of luck.
